AMD's Toyshop demo reveals visual quality issues
AMD's RX 9000-series graphics cards were recently announced, showcasing advanced technology in a tech demo called Toyshop. However, the demo revealed issues like ghosting and visual artifacts, raising concerns about the image quality of the new cards. The Toyshop demo features a robot navigating a toy shop and a futuristic street. Despite showcasing AMD's graphics capabilities, viewers noted significant visual errors, including blurry pixels and shimmering reflections, which detracted from the overall presentation. While AMD aims to compete with Nvidia's offerings, the demo's flaws may impact consumer perception. Nvidia's DLSS 4 technology is noted for its superior image quality, which could influence buyers' choices between the two brands.
